How Much Does It Cost to Build a Messaging App Like WhatsApp?
Scope of Work

Looking to build a WhatsApp like messaging app for your business? One of the first questions that comes to mind is: How much does it cost to develop an app like WhatsApp?
Here’s a quick breakdown of development costs based on app complexity:
| WhatsApp App Type | Estimated Development Cost |
|---|---|
| Simple App (Basic Features) | $25,000 – $35,000 |
| Medium App (Advanced Features) | $35,000 – $45,000 |
| Complex App (Highly Advanced Features) | Starts from $50,000 |
A basic WhatsApp clone typically starts at $25,000, but the final cost depends on multiple factors, including:
-
Development team’s location
-
Team size and expertise
-
The app development company you hire
-
Platforms (iOS, Android, or cross platform)
-
Features and level of complexity
With WhatsApp’s user base continually expanding, this is an excellent time for entrepreneurs to enter the messaging app market. According to Statista, WhatsApp is projected to reach almost 3 billion monthly active users in 2024, reflecting a 7% growth compared to 2023.
Here’s a screenshot of the users from January 2020 to June 2022.

As a leading mobile app development company in the USA, we understand the technical and financial components involved in building high performing clone apps.
In this guide, you’ll learn:
-
The quick cost to build simple, medium, and complex WhatsApp style apps
-
The overall cost of developing a messaging application
-
Key factors that influence app development costs
-
Practical tips to reduce development expenses
Let’s explore everything you need to know before creating your own WhatsApp like application.
How Much Does App Development Cost? [Quick Answer]

The cost of developing a mobile application typically ranges from $25,000 to $200,000, depending on the app’s complexity, feature set, and development timeline. Below is a structured breakdown of WhatsApp style app development costs to give you a precise idea of what to expect.
WhatsApp Like App Development Cost Breakdown
| WhatsApp App Type | Must Have Features | Timeline | Estimated Cost |
|---|---|---|---|
| Simple App (Basic Features) | Text, image, video & audio messaging Group chat Push notifications Contact list Profile creation & editing |
2–3 months | $25,000 – $35,000 |
| Medium App (Advanced Features) | Everything in Simple + Voice & video calls End to end encryption File sharing (PDFs, documents) Location sharing In app media viewer |
4–7 months | $35,000 – $45,000 |
| Complex App (Highly Advanced Features) | Everything in Medium + Multi language support Third party integrations (calendar, to do apps, etc.) Advanced security (2FA, enhanced encryption) UI theme customization Business features (automated replies, CRM tools) |
8–12 months | Starts from $50,000 |
These estimates serve as general guidelines. Actual cost varies depending on:
-
Your required features and level of customization
-
App complexity and scalability goals
-
Development platform (iOS, Android, Cross platform)
-
The experience and location of your development team
Quick Formula for Estimating App Development Cost
You can calculate a rough estimate using this simple formula:
Total App Development Cost = Development Hours × Hourly Rate
This acts as a quick, reliable app development cost calculator to help you budget effectively.
Now that you understand the estimated cost based on features and timelines, let’s explore the key factors that influence the overall cost of building an instant messaging app like WhatsApp.
Need a Cost Estimate for Your WhatsApp Like App?
Share your app requirements with us and receive:
-
A free, no obligation cost estimate
-
A transparent, detailed price breakdown
-
Competitive rates tailored to your project
Ready to get started? Let’s help you turn your messaging app idea into reality.
Which Factors Impact the Cost of Developing a WhatsApp Like App?
Understanding the factors that influence your development budget is essential before building a WhatsApp style messaging app. Below is a comprehensive breakdown of what affects the total cost and how each factor contributes to the overall budget.

1. WhatsApp App Development Platform – iOS, Android, or Cross Platform
The platform you choose significantly affects development cost because each platform requires different tools, frameworks, and testing processes. Development time (and therefore cost) varies depending on whether you build for:
-
iOS
-
Android
-
Both (native)
-
Cross platform (Flutter/React Native)
Below is an estimated breakdown based on an hourly rate of $15–$25:
iOS vs. Android
Building for both platforms is more expensive because each requires separate development and testing standards. Apple and Google also have different publishing fees and guidelines.
Native vs. Hybrid Development
-
Native apps: Higher cost, highest performance, best user experience
-
Cross platform: Lower cost, faster development, shared codebase
Platform Updates
When iOS or Android releases new OS versions, updates may be required contributing to long term development costs.
2. UI/UX Design Requirements for Your WhatsApp Like App
High quality UI/UX design increases user engagement but also affects cost. Design typically involves three stages:
| Component | Description | Timeline | Estimated Cost |
|---|---|---|---|
| Wireframing | Layout sketches & user flow | 30–80 hrs | $450–$1200 |
| Prototype | Interactive demo for testing UX | 30–100 hrs | $450–$1500 |
| Visual Design | Final UI with colors, icons, branding | 120–140 hrs (per platform) | $1800–$2100 |
Complex, custom UI or animations increase design time and cost.
3. Features to Integrate Into a WhatsApp Style Messaging App
The features you choose play one of the biggest roles in development cost.
| Feature | Description | Timeline |
|---|---|---|
| Text Messaging | Real time messages | 100–150 hrs |
| Voice & Video Calls | In app audio/video communication | 180–240 hrs |
| Group Chat | Chats for teams, families, communities | 120–180 hrs |
| Media Sharing | Send images, videos, files | 80–150 hrs |
| End to End Encryption | Security & privacy | 40–70 hrs |
| Push Notifications | Alerts & message updates | 50–80 hrs |
| Contact Management | Sync & manage contacts | 40–80 hrs |
| User Profiles | Personalization | 50–60 hrs |
| Chat Backup | Restore message history | 120–190 hrs |
| Status Updates | 24 hour stories | 50–60 hrs |
| Location Sharing | GPS based features | 60–90 hrs |
| Payment Integration | P2P transfers | 160–240 hrs |
| Multi language Support | Global accessibility | 40–70 hrs |
| Theme Customization | Color themes, wallpapers | 60–80 hrs |
Your feature list defines your total budget more advanced features = more development hours.
4. Cost Based on the App Development Team You Hire
The type of development team you choose heavily influences cost:
Minimum Team Required to Build a WhatsApp Clone
-
1–2 Project Managers
-
1–2 Business Analysts
-
2–3 Frontend Developers
-
2–3 Backend Developers
-
1–2 UI/UX Designers
-
1–2 QA Engineers
Hiring Options
A. App Development Company (Recommended)
Why choose a development company?
-
Experienced team of designers, developers, PMs
-
Established workflows ensure timely delivery
-
Access to advanced tools and licensed software
-
Dedicated QA teams ensure stable performance
-
Long term support and maintenance
-
Higher reliability, predictable communication
Hiring Models Offered
-
Part time Developers – lowest cost
-
Hourly Developers – flexible, cost based on hours worked
-
Full time Developers – highest cost but fastest delivery
B. Freelancers
Pros:
-
Lower rates
-
Flexible scheduling
-
Personalized working relationships
Cons:
-
Limited expertise for large, complex apps
-
No quality assurance processes
-
Higher security risks
-
Harder to manage multiple freelancers
-
Slower scalability
Freelancers are suitable only for small tasks, not full WhatsApp style platforms.
5. Cost Based on Developer Location
Developer rates vary significantly between countries. Here is an updated comparison:
| Region | iOS ($/hr) | Android ($/hr) | Cross Platform ($/hr) |
|---|---|---|---|
| Canada | 90–120 | 80–140 | 90–120 |
| USA | 60–120 | 60–120 | 60–130 |
| Latin America | 28–90 | 28–90 | 40–160 |
| UK | 60–75 | 60–75 | 55–75 |
| Europe | 35–55 | 35–55 | 30–50 |
| Ukraine | 40–78 | 38–60 | 40–78 |
| South Africa | 45–80 | 40–80 | 40–80 |
| India | 22–90 | 15–25 | 20–30 |
| Southeast Asia | 23–55 | 30–45 | 30–45 |
| Asia | 23–55 | 20–30 | 25–35 |
| Vietnam | 18–35 | 15–30 | 20–35 |
⭐ Why Vietnam Is One of the Best Countries for App Development
Vietnam has rapidly become a top global software outsourcing destination. Here’s why:
1. Exceptionally Competitive Rates
-
40–60% cheaper than US/EU
-
Lower cost than Singapore, Malaysia, and other Southeast Asian markets
2. Strong Engineering Talent
Vietnam ranks top 10 globally (HackerRank) in developer skills especially in:
-
Backend systems
-
Flutter/React Native
-
AI, computer vision, and real time communication
3. Excellent Communication & Work Ethic
-
English proficiency improving quickly
-
Strong commitment to deadlines
-
Highly adaptive, familiar with Agile/Scrum
4. Growing Technology Ecosystem
-
Thousands of IT outsourcing companies
-
Many firms are ISO & CMMI certified
-
Vietnam frequently develops software for US, EU, Singapore, and Australia markets
5. High Quality at a Lower Cost
Vietnam offers premium quality development at significantly lower prices ideal for startups seeking maximum ROI without compromising quality.
Now That You Know the Cost Factors, What’s Next?
Understanding these factors helps you make smarter decisions for your messaging app project.
If you need:
-
A cost estimate
-
A development strategy
-
A feature roadmap
-
A cross platform vs. native comparison
-
A Vietnam vs. global cost analysis
We’re here to help.
Need Help Developing an App Like WhatsApp?
Whether you want a full development team or expert guidance, we can support you at every step.
👉 Share your requirements with us today for a free consultation and cost estimate.
How to Reduce WhatsApp Development Costs (5 Practical Tips)
Here are five effective strategies to lower your messaging app development costs when outsourcing to an app development company:
1. Prioritize Essential Features
Focus on the core features your target audience truly needs such as real time messaging, file sharing, and media uploads. Eliminating non essential or “nice to have” features early on helps:
-
Reduce development time
-
Minimize complexity
-
Maintain budget control
For example, in a WhatsApp like app, features like secure messaging and media sharing matter more than advanced customizations. Prioritizing what delivers the most value helps keep costs manageable.
2. Choose the Right Platform
Select the platform that aligns best with your users iOS, Android, or both.
If most of your audience is on a single platform, building there first significantly reduces cost.
You can always expand to additional platforms later once the app gains traction.
3. Use Templates or Pre Built Components
Leverage existing templates, UI kits, and reusable modules instead of coding everything from scratch. This approach can:
-
Cut weeks off development
-
Reduce design and coding workload
-
Lower your total project cost
Many components of messaging apps such as chat layouts or authentication flows can be efficiently reused.
4. Hire a Small, Skilled Development Team
A smaller, highly experienced team is often more efficient than a large, expensive team. You benefit from:
-
Faster decision making
-
Lower management overhead
-
Stronger product consistency
A lean team can deliver high quality results at a significantly lower cost.
5. Collaborate Closely and Provide Clear Requirements
Miscommunication and unclear requirements are major causes of cost overruns.
You can prevent these issues by:
-
Providing detailed specifications
-
Sharing user stories, feature lists, mockups, or examples
-
Reviewing progress frequently
-
Giving fast, clear feedback
This minimizes rework, reduces delays, and keeps the app aligned with your goals.
By using these cost saving strategies, you can build a high quality WhatsApp style app without overspending. While budget optimization is important, quality should never be compromised. Make sure you choose a development company that delivers strong results at a fair price.
How HomeNest Software Helps Determine the Cost of Developing a WhatsApp Clone
Building a messaging app like WhatsApp is a complex project that requires careful planning, robust design, and expert execution. The total development cost depends on several factors including platform choices, feature set, UI/UX design, team size, and developer location.
HomeNest Software helps you make accurate, strategic decisions by offering:
-
Detailed cost estimation based on your exact features and business goals
-
Professional guidance from experts experienced in building scalable, secure chat apps
-
Transparent development roadmap outlining timelines, milestones, and deliverables
-
End to end development support, from concept to launch
With extensive experience building high performance apps for hundreds of clients worldwide, HomeNest Software ensures your WhatsApp like app is reliable, scalable, and designed for long term success.
Whether you’re a startup or an enterprise, we help turn your idea into a fully functional, market ready mobile application.
Contact HomeNest Software today for a free consultation and inquire about our all inclusive App Design package offers!
HomeNest Software – Empowering Long Term Growth for Modern Businesses.

Contact Information:
- Address: The Sun Avenue, 28 Mai Chi Tho Street, Binh Trung Ward, Ho Chi Minh City
- Hotline: +84 898 994 298 ( WhatsApp )
- Website: homenest.software
HomeNest Services: Website Design – App Design – Software Development – Digital Marketing.
FAQs
1. How much does it cost to develop an app like WhatsApp?
The cost to develop a WhatsApp style messaging app typically ranges from $25,000 to $50,000+, depending on features, complexity, platform choice, design requirements, and team location. Advanced capabilities such as voice/video calls, encryption, and cloud backup increase the total cost.
2. How long does it take to build a WhatsApp like app?
The development timeline varies by complexity:
-
Simple version: 2–3 months
-
Medium version: 4–7 months
-
Complex version: 8–12+ months
Factors like features, integrations, team size, and feedback cycles affect the total duration.
3. What features are essential for a WhatsApp clone?
Core features typically include:
-
Real time messaging
-
Media sharing (images, videos, documents)
-
Voice and video calling
-
Push notifications
-
User profiles
-
Contact syncing
-
End to end encryption
Additional features such as payment integration, theme customization, status updates, or cloud backup can be added depending on your business goals.
4. Can I reduce the cost of developing a WhatsApp like app?
Yes. You can lower development costs by:
-
Building an MVP before the full version
-
Prioritizing essential features only
-
Choosing a single platform at first
-
Using pre built templates or modules
-
Hiring a smaller, skilled team
-
Outsourcing to cost effective countries like Vietnam
5. Why is Vietnam a great choice for outsourcing WhatsApp app development?
Vietnam offers one of the best combinations of quality, affordability, and talent:
-
Competitive hourly rates (significantly lower than US/EU)
-
Skilled developers familiar with messaging apps, AI, and real time systems
-
Strong English communication and excellent work ethic
-
A rapidly growing tech ecosystem with CMMI and ISO certified companies
Vietnam provides enterprise level quality at a fraction of Western development costs.
6. Should I choose native or cross platform development for my WhatsApp clone?
-
Native development (Swift/Kotlin): Best performance, highest quality, ideal for apps requiring heavy real time features
-
Cross platform (Flutter/React Native): Faster and more cost effective, suitable for MVPs or multi platform apps
Your choice depends on budget, performance expectations, and timeline.
7. How do I choose the right app development company?
Look for a company with:
-
Proven experience in messaging or social apps
-
A strong portfolio and client testimonials
-
Clear pricing and transparent processes
-
Strong communication and project management
-
Post launch support and long term maintenance
HomeNest Software provides all of the above, plus free consultation and NDA protection.
8. Do I need ongoing maintenance after launching the app?
Yes. Ongoing maintenance is essential to:
-
Fix bugs
-
Improve security
-
Release new features
-
Ensure compatibility with OS updates
-
Scale the backend as your user base grows
Most successful messaging apps require monthly or quarterly updates.
9. Can HomeNest Software help estimate the exact development cost for my WhatsApp like app?
Absolutely. HomeNest Software analyzes your concept, feature list, market goals, and technical requirements to provide a detailed, accurate cost estimate and timeline. You’ll also receive strategic recommendations to optimize cost without sacrificing quality.
Latest Articles
View All
Criteria For Choosing The Right App Design Agency
UI/UX design is the logical foundation of a system, not merely a visual element. Choosing the wrong partner will directly lead to technical debt, budget overruns, and disruptions in the development process. This article provides a 6-step evaluation framework and a list of operational risks, helping businesses eliminate subjective design advice and accurately assess agency capabilities based on developer handoff standards and practical business performance.

How Does AI in Banking Industry Impact the Future?
Artificial intelligence (AI) has transitioned from a supplementary tool to a core infrastructure of financial data management, optimizing profitability through real-time fraud detection, natural language processing (NLP), and high-speed credit scoring models. “Deploying AI in the financial sector requires more than just algorithmic accuracy, it demands a highly secure cloud architecture and rigorous data governance,” commented Nguyen Tien, co-founder of HomeNest Software. Why read this guide? We skip the theoretical jargon to focus entirely on technical implementation. Whether you’re evaluating a vendor or planning a system overhaul, this article will detail: Operational Efficiency: Automating unstructured data workflows at scale. Risk Architecture: Implementing real-time threat detection and AML compliance. Data ownership: The essential need for 100% ownership of the source code to ensure full algorithm auditability.

How to Make a Banking App like Bank of America?
Developing a mobile banking application like Bank of America extends far beyond basic UI design; it requires engineering a fault-tolerant backend capable of real-time ledger synchronization, biometric authentication, and high-volume data processing under strict regulatory frameworks. Drawing from HomeNest Software’s deep experience in architecting enterprise-grade fintech solutions, this guide strips away theoretical jargon to focus entirely on operational and technical execution. What you will find in this guide: We break down the precise development roadmap, from mapping out microservices and ensuring PCI-DSS compliance to estimating MVP development costs and securing absolute data sovereignty through 100% source code ownership. If you are preparing to build, scale, or audit a financial platform, this blueprint provides the exact framework you need.

Banking App Development Cost
Building a banking application is rarely a simple process; it’s a complex technical challenge requiring a balance between complying with stringent financial regulations, handling large transaction volumes, and a scalable cloud architecture. Miscalculating these technical requirements from the outset often leads to significant technical debt and budget overruns. Based on HomeNest Software’s practical experience in designing enterprise-grade fintech solutions, this guide bypasses generic estimates to provide a realistic analysis of banking application development costs. What you’ll find in this guide: We analyze the true cost factors, from technology selection and API integration to the hidden costs of regulatory compliance and security infrastructure. Whether you’re launching a minimum viable product or expanding an existing financial platform, this analysis provides the precise operational data you need to plan your budget effectively.

How to Build a Mobile Banking App Like Chime?
Building a mobile banking app like Chime is not just about features, it is about delivering a secure, scalable, and user-centric financial experience. From planning the right architecture to optimizing mobile banking app development cost, every decision directly impacts your product’s success. Leveraging Fintech app development services, starting with MVP app development, and scaling through on-demand app development solutions allows businesses to reduce risk and accelerate time to market. To stay competitive, combining Android app development services and iOS app development solutions ensures wider reach, while continuous updates through maintenance software development services keep your app secure and future-ready.

How to Build a Banking App Like Barclays: A Complete Entrepreneur’s Guide
Building a banking app like Barclays requires more than just development. It demands a strong product vision, secure architecture, and a clear monetization strategy. From optimizing cost and selecting the right tech stack to ensuring compliance and scalability, every decision impacts long-term success. Partnering with an experienced team like HomeNest Software helps accelerate development, reduce risks, and deliver a high-quality fintech product that can compete in today’s fast-evolving digital banking landscape.